About the role

The SEO Strategist will provide strategic leadership, execution support, and act as primary client liaison for a subset of Amsive's organic and AI search client accounts. We’re looking for a curious problem solver to lead a team of SEO Analysts and Specialists and support our wider department with content and technical strategies, and help develop impactful, data-driven SEO and AI search campaigns for our clients.

Responsibilities

  • Translating client objectives into effective organic and AI search marketing strategies
  • Conducting comprehensive, prioritized site audits and proactively identifying content and technical SEO opportunities that drive relevant organic visibility and traffic at scale
  • Documenting recommended solutions in a concise and compelling manner, working with development teams to advise on implementation
  • Developing realistic business cases to convince clients to prioritize and implement SEO initiatives
  • Deriving strategic search query and prompt evaluations to drive successful initiatives based on attainable organic and AI search opportunities
  • Monitoring and analyzing site performance using a range of SEO, AI, and site analytics tools
  • Interpreting and explaining data discoveries as they relate to organic and AI search, specific initiatives, and client KPIs
  • Developing and effectively communicating SEO and AI search strategies, deliverables, and results
  • Performing competitive analyses to identify organic search opportunities
  • Identifying opportunities to improve organic conversion rates
  • Supervising QA of SEO implementations
  • Acting as primary client contact, providing education for clients around organic search strategies, tactics, deliverables, and performance
  • Leading (and inspiring) a team of 1-3 members in the execution of client SEO and AI search programs
  • Staying up to date on current search industry trends and technologies, and proactively communicating these trends to clients and the broader Amsive team

Requirements

  • 6+ years or more of experience contributing to or managing SEO programs, preferably in an agency setting
  • Evidence of success with previous SEO campaigns for medium to large brands
  • Strong understanding of current SEO and AI search best practices, search engine ranking factors, cross-channel marketing principles, and a strong grasp on how to help clients meet business goals as realistically as possible, setting the right expectations
  • Strong understanding of concepts such as URL discovery, crawling, rendering, indexing, and ‘crawl budget’
  • Understanding of web performance and page speed optimizations
  • Inside-out knowledge of Screaming Frog and Google Search Console
  • Experience using other enterprise SEO tools such as Botify, Lumar, OnCrawl, Ryte, BrightEdge, STAT, SEMrush, ahrefs, etc.
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ills, a positive attitude, and the ability to thrive in a collaborative and fast-paced environment
  • Strong project management and organization skills, ability to be flexible and adaptable and prioritize and manage multiple concurrent projects
  • Experience with Google Analytics, Looker Studio, and connected APIs for data analysis and reporting
  • Familiarity with HTML, CSS, and JavaScript (as it relates to SEO)
